It is harlequin phase dusky plus homozygous blue dilution, so basically Apricot Silver/Snowy. The birds that Dave created he did so from breeding Silver Headed Australian Spotteds to Miniature Appleyards/Silver Bantams.
I have a lot of extra hens in the Overbergs and extra drakes this year in my Silver Bantams, so I am thinking about breeding some together to create some Blue Silvers with the idea then of the following year breeding the Blue Silvers together to get Silvers and Apricot Silvers to outcross back to the original birds.
